Pakistan holding ransom Afghan exiles

mercredi 29 novembre 2023 à 02:49

Pakistan is holding for ransom some 45,000 Afghan exiles to whom the UK and US want to give asylum, charging $830 to allow each of those exiles to leave Pakistan.

That puts Pakistan in the amazing self-contradictory position of demanding they leave and blocking them from leaving.

The only other case of demanding ransoms for people to leave was when the Soviet Union agreed to allow Jews to emigrate, and charged a ransom for each "exit visa".

Do the US and UK give Pakistan any foreign aid? It would be natural to threaten to deduct these exit ransoms from that aid.
